In this post, we’ll walk through the top integrations worth plugging into your BigCommerce B2B Edition setup in 2025. What Is BigCommerce B2B Edition? BigCommerce didn’t always speak B2B. For years, the platform served DTC brands best. Then the B2B Edition came along and changed the story. It was built for manufacturers, wholesalers, and distributors who needed more than just a shopping cart. Think customer-specific pricing, shared company accounts, requisition lists, and punchout catalogs. All baked in from day one. McKinsey’s latest B2B Pulse shows that more than two-thirds of B2B buyers now prefer remote or digital self-service during the purchasing cycle. Therefore, having these workflows native is no longer a nice-to-have. What makes it different? BigCommerce B2B Edition does the heavy lifting with built-in features that make it a favorite for serious brands that want to scale without starting from scratch. BigCommerce BackOrder Running out of inventory doesn’t have to end the sale. With BigCommerce BackOrder, customers can buy even when a product is out of stock without you manually flipping a switch. You control how the backorder works: The system also gives you analytics on how many sales you’re saving and where demand is headed. For B2B sellers who manage supply chain fluctuations, deal with long lead times, or want to avoid zeroing out products with long production cycles, this is a no-brainer. Best for: B2B stores with complex approval flows and personalized pricing models. B2B Ninja: Quotes Without the Chaos B2B buyers expect quotes and they expect them fast. B2B Ninja adds quoting directly to your storefront. Customers can click “Request a Quote” from product or cart pages, and you can respond with branded, downloadable PDFs. Quotes live in a centralized dashboard so your sales reps don’t have to dig through emails. You can: It’s a great lightweight solution for stores that don’t need full CPQ systems but want more than just email back-and-forth. Best for: Sales-driven B2B stores that quote often and want a cleaner process. ShipperHQ: Smart Shipping That Matches Complex B2B Needs Shipping is rarely simple in B2B. ShipperHQ helps you build logic-driven shipping rates that factor in order value, weight, customer location, or even product types. It also supports: This is one of those tools you don’t think about until you start losing deals over shipping costs or delivery windows. Best for: B2B sellers shipping large, heavy, or custom-packed orders. Feedonomics: Clean Product Feeds Across Channels Feedonomics keeps your product data consistent across marketplaces and ad platforms. It takes your catalog and formats it to match the specific requirements of Google Shopping, Facebook Ads, Amazon, Walmart, and more. You avoid feed disapprovals, and your listings look polished no matter where customers find you. Best for: Multi-channel sellers who care about brand consistency and ad performance. Sellbrite: Sync Orders and Listings Across Marketplaces Sellbrite acts like your control tower for inventory. It syncs listings, stock, and orders across Amazon, Walmart, eBay, and other major platforms so you don’t oversell or miss fulfillment deadlines. Inventory changes in BigCommerce reflect everywhere automatically. Best for: Stores managing multiple sales channels from a central warehouse. What Is Shopify POS Workflow Automation? Shopify POS workflow automation refers to the use of software tools and integrations to automatically execute retail operations that are traditionally done manually. This includes: Automation reduces human error, saves time, and improves consistency across both online and offline channels. Quick Fact: Shopify POS integrates natively with Shopify’s ecommerce backend, making automation across online and retail stores seamless. Why Automation Matters for Retailers Whether you’re a small boutique or a national franchise, manual workflows can slow down your team and limit your scalability. Here are the top benefits of automating Shopify POS workflows: Save Time on Repetitive Tasks Eliminate manual data entry, stock adjustments, and receipt handling by setting up automated rules and triggers. Enhance Inventory Accuracy Avoid overselling and stockouts by syncing inventory automatically between your physical store and Shopify’s online platform. Deliver Personalized Customer Experiences Automated workflows allow you to send loyalty emails, tag VIP customers, and create custom offers based on in-store behavior. Here’s a breakdown of common retail workflows you can automate in Shopify POS, along with real-world examples: Customer Tagging & CRM Syncing Automatically tag customers at checkout (e.g., “First-time buyer”, “Repeat customer”, “Spent over $200”) and sync this data with your email marketing or CRM platform. Example Workflow: Email Receipt and Follow-ups Send receipts automatically via email, followed by product care tips, upsell recommendations, or review requests. Tool: Klaviyo, Omnisend, Shopify Email Inventory Adjustments and Alerts Auto-update stock levels across all channels and send internal alerts when inventory reaches reorder points. Tool: Shopify Flow + StockyExample: “If stock for Product A < 5, send Slack alert to warehouse team.” Employee Performance Reports Track in-store staff performance by automating weekly summaries of sales, average order value, and upsell success. Tool: Better Reports, Report Pundit Abandoned Cart Recovery (For Hybrid Retailers) If a customer browses online and purchases in-store (or vice versa), automation helps reconnect with them through omnichannel recovery flows.
